I finally got the headstrap streaming app to update.  I needed to reset the headset, including going through all the setup again.  Then instead of starting off with wifi streaming I plugged in my usb3 Link cable, selected do nothing, then started up the pc streaming app.  Then I selected the usb connection option andn then tried updating and it updated the headset streaming app.

After all that, I can't say I noticed any difference.  I did manage to go in and out of the Lobby a couple times without any problems, but eventually my PC hung again and I needed to do a hard restart by press/holding my PC power button.

I've still found it best to initially select SteamVR in the lobby and then select Steam and VivePort PCVR apps from the SeamVR void with library panel.  Then use in-game options to quit or hit the left controller menu button to select stop the app.  

Again, to stop streaming without hanging my PC I needed to do the same thing as before; hit the x button on the SteamVR popup to close VR and once it closed, to immediately hit the x button on the Streamer popup to stop/end it.  Then I just hold the headset power button and select shutdown.  All a lot more complicated to do but at least it doesn't hang my PC.  Hopefully when Virtual Desktop is released this will make all this a lot easier.  Plus it should give you more streaming options as well.
